Is there a way to estimate the needed AVCHD bitrate to approximate the quality of MPEG2 bitrate of the same material (typically fast moving sports)?
In other words, what AVCHD bitrate would approximate MPEG 2 @ 35mpbs, MPEG 2 @ 50 mbps (fast moving sports)?
Thanks.
-wolv
The general rule is half. MPEG4 at 25 Mbps will have about the same quality as MPEG2 at 50 Mbps (all else being equal).
That is a very loose rule of thumb, however. There are a lot of factors at play here that give MPEG 4 certain advantages that MPEG 2 will never have.

would that mean AVC codecs are better with things like fast moving sports than MPEG2 would be?
Yep, pretty much in all ways, AVCHD beats MPEG-2 based camcorders. It's about 10 years younger as a video technology so there are lots of tweaks. AVCHD is able to do more with less - about 50% less as indicated here on this thread.
